ECON 325 - Introduction to Forecasting Description: An introduction to methods employed in business and econometric forecasting. Topics include time series modeling, Box-Jenkins models, and seasonal adjustments. Covers data collection methods, graphing, model building, model interpretation and presentation of results.
Prerequisites & Notes: Prerequisites, MATH 170 or MATH 172, ECON 324.
Credits: (5)
